WebbLinkedIn is the world’s largest business network, helping professionals like Rich Riley discover inside connections to recommended job candidates, … Rich Riley (born August 17, 1973) is an American businessman and entrepreneur. Currently, he is co-CEO of Origin Materials, a chemicals and materials company. He was formerly the Chief Executive Officer of Shazam. He was an executive at Yahoo! from 1999 to 2013.
